3 of a Kind, also known as "Trips", "Set" or "Prile" (from its use in 3 Card Poker), is a poker hand which contains three cards of the same rank, plus two unmatched cards. In Texas Hold 'Em, a "Set" refers specifically to a 3 of a Kind comprised of a pocket pair and one card of matching rank on the board. A kicker, also called a side card, is a card in a poker hand that does not itself take part in determining the rank of the hand, but that may be used to break ties between hands of the same rank. For example, the hand Q-Q-10-5-2 is ranked as a pair of queens. The 10, 5, and 2 are kickers.

Tie Breaker Rules of Poker Cash Game - Poker Rules 11 rows · Poker Rules - Know the detailed Tie Breaker Rules of Poker Cash Game at Adda52.com. … Poker Three Of a Kind Tie - martinval.com Poker combinationsFive of a kind is a poker hand containing five cards of the same rank, such as 3♥ 3. ♦ 3♣ 3♠ 3 ("five of a kind, threes"). It ranks above a straight flush but is only possible when using one or more wild cards, as there are only four cards of each rank in a standard 52-card deck.
